如何确保在云服务器上为多个服务分配不同端口时避免冲突?

随着云计算技术的发展,越来越多的企业和个人选择将应用程序部署到云服务器上。当在同一台云服务器上运行多个服务时,正确地为每个服务分配不同的端口是至关重要的,以确保它们能够正常工作而不发生冲突。本文将探讨几种有效的策略来防止端口冲突。

如何确保在云服务器上为多个服务分配不同端口时避免冲突?

理解端口号的作用与范围

端口是网络通信中的一个重要概念,它用于标识特定的服务或进程。在TCP/IP协议中,端口号是一个16位的数字,其取值范围从0到65535。其中,0-1023之间的端口通常被称为“熟知端口”,这些端口由IANA(互联网号码分配机构)管理和分配给一些常用的服务;1024-49151之间的端口称为“注册端口”,可以被用户和企业申请使用;而49152-65535之间的端口则是动态或私有端口,可以自由使用。

规划端口分配方案

为了防止端口冲突,在部署多个服务之前,应该先制定一个合理的端口分配方案。这包括确定每个服务所需的端口数量、了解所选云服务商提供的默认端口配置以及参考行业标准等。还可以利用端口扫描工具对目标服务器进行扫描,找出当前未被占用的可用端口。

采用虚拟主机技术

如果多个网站或Web应用需要在同一台云服务器上运行,并且它们都监听相同的HTTP(S)端口(如80/443),那么可以考虑使用虚拟主机技术。通过设置不同的域名或IP地址作为区分依据,即使所有服务都在同一个物理端口上也能实现独立访问。

使用容器化平台

容器化技术如Docker可以让开发者更方便地隔离各个服务之间的环境,从而避免端口冲突的问题。每个容器都有自己独立的网络命名空间,因此可以在不改变外部暴露端口的情况下内部随意指定服务监听的端口。像Kubernetes这样的编排工具还提供了更加高级的功能,例如自动分配可用端口、负载均衡等。

定期检查与维护

随着时间推移,可能会有新的服务加入或者旧的服务停止运行,这就要求管理员定期检查现有服务的状态及其使用的端口情况。及时更新端口分配表,并根据实际情况调整相应的防火墙规则和服务配置文件。

在云服务器上为多个服务分配不同端口时避免冲突并不是一件难事。只要我们充分理解端口号的作用与范围,合理规划端口分配方案,灵活运用各种技术和工具,并保持良好的维护习惯,就可以轻松实现多服务共存的目标。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/58381.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月17日 下午10:16
下一篇 2025年1月17日 下午10:16

相关推荐

  • 云服务器生产企业排名:选择时应考虑哪些关键因素?

    在当今数字化时代,企业越来越依赖云计算来存储、管理和处理数据。云服务器作为云计算的核心组成部分,其性能和可靠性对于企业的运营至关重要。市场上众多的云服务提供商让人眼花缭乱,如何挑选出最适合自己的云服务器成为了一项重要任务。以下是选择云服务器生产企业时需要考虑的关键因素。 品牌声誉与市场地位 一个知名品牌的背后往往代表着可靠的产品质量和良好的售后服务。在选择云…

    2025年1月17日
    500
  • 云服务器的网络架构是怎样的?确保低延迟和高带宽传输的秘密

    云服务器的网络架构是一种复杂的系统,它由多个组件组成,包括但不限于:计算节点、存储节点、网络设备(如交换机、路由器等)以及管理节点。在云数据中心中,所有这些组件都通过高速网络连接在一起。而云计算服务提供商通常会将分布在不同地理位置的数据中心连接起来,形成一个庞大的分布式计算网络。 确保低延迟和高带宽传输的秘密 1. 优化硬件设施 为了确保低延迟和高带宽的传输…

    2025年1月17日
    500
  • 云服务器带宽不足怎么办?教你几招优化网络性能!

    在当今数字化时代,云服务器已经成为众多企业和个人进行数据存储、网站托管等操作的首选。在使用云服务器的过程中,可能会遇到带宽不足的问题。这不仅会降低用户体验,还可能导致业务运营受阻。那么当云服务器带宽不足时我们该怎么办呢?以下是一些优化网络性能的方法。 一、选择合适的云服务商 云服务商的选择对于带宽有着至关重要的影响。一些大型云服务提供商如阿里云、腾讯云等都拥…

    2025年1月24日
    400
  • 阿里云服务器数据备份:如何通过API实现自动化操作?

    在当今数字化时代,数据的重要性不言而喻。企业需要确保其关键数据得到及时、安全的备份,以应对可能发生的意外情况。阿里云提供了强大的服务器数据备份功能,用户可以通过调用API接口轻松实现自动化备份操作。 了解阿里云API 阿里云的API是一套用于与阿里云服务进行交互的编程接口。开发者可以使用这些API来创建、管理和监控各种资源。对于数据备份而言,主要涉及到ECS…

    2025年1月18日
    1300
  • 通过云服务器进行数据备份和恢复:确保业务连续性的关键步骤

    随着信息技术的飞速发展,越来越多的企业开始依赖云计算技术来存储、处理和传输数据。在享受便捷的如何保障数据的安全性和可靠性成为了企业必须面对的重要问题。其中,通过云服务器实现数据备份与恢复是确保业务连续性不可或缺的一环。 选择可靠的云服务提供商 在选择云服务提供商时,需要综合考虑多个因素,包括但不限于服务商的品牌口碑、服务质量、安全性保障措施以及技术支持能力等…

    2025年1月18日
    800

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部